Starz places The Chair online

US cablenet Starz will make the first five episodes of its upcoming reality show The Chair available online before being broadcast on the linear network.

The episodes will be accessible to subscribers of Starz Play and Starz On Demand from September 6, with the show debuting later that day on the network at 23.00.

Chris Albrecht, CEO at Starz, said the move was designed “to reach a young adult population that is in the vanguard of ‘bingeing’ on shows as their preferred method of viewing.”

Created by Oscar-winning exec producer Chris Moore, The Chair follows directors Shane Dawson and Anna Martemucci as they use the same screenplay and identical budgets to create their own films.

The resulting films will then air on Starz, with viewers voting to decide which director should be awarded US$250,000.

The 10-part series, greenlit in April, is being exec produced by Moore and Anthony B Sacco, in partnership with Starz, Steel Town Entertainment Project and Before the Door Pictures.
